Study On The Inhibitory Effect Of 1,10-Decanediol On Quroum Sensing Of Aeromonas Salmon And Its Preservation Effect On Larimichthys Crocea

Quorum sensing system is a mechanism of information exchange between bacteria.It produces and senses N-acyl-homoserine lactones to monitor population density and regulate many physiological functions of bacteria,such as bioluminescence,bacterial movement,toxin secretion,biofilm formation and the production of other secondary metabolites.When bacteria carry out these physiological activities,they will cause food corruption.Quorum sensing inhibitors are substances that can destroy or interfere with the QS system among bacteria.The ideal QS inhibitors have been defined as chemically stable and efficient low molecular weight molecules,which have high specificity for QS regulation and have no side effects.Aquatic products are indispensable food in our life.They are not only rich in nutrition,but also have delicious taste.However,due to soft muscle tissue,high water content,and easy oxidation of unsaturated fatty acids,they are prone to corruption in the process of storage and transportation.The deterioration of aquatic products will cause serious economic losses.There are many reasons for the deterioration of aquatic products.The mechanism of corruption is related to the complex changes of biology,chemistry and physics.It is found that microorganisms are the most common cause of spoilage of aquatic products.In recent years,different types of signal molecules have been detected in the food spoilage caused by microorganisms,and the expression of virulence factors and decay factors are mainly mediated by AHLs in fish spoilage bacteria,thus affecting the spoilage of aquatic products.The quorum sensing system is involved in the regulation of microbial spoilage.Aeromonas salmon is a kind of spoilage bacteria of aquatic products.The inhibition effect of 1,10-decanediol on the colony induction of A.salmon was studied.And the effect of 1,10-decanediol as a preservative on Larimichthys crocea.The results show that:1.In this study,1,10-decanediol was used as the research object.The Anti-quorum-sensing activity of 1,10-decanediol was verified by the production of characteristic purple bacteriocin of Chromobacterium violaceum CV026,and the inhibition effect of 1,10-decanediol on quorum sensing and putrefaction of Aeromonas salmon was explored under the condition of sub-minimal inhibitory concentration.The results showed that 1,10-decanediol had a strong inhibitory effect on the extracellular protease activity,swarming and swimming motility,biofilm formation and other related corruption characteristics of A.salmon,and the inhibitory effect was enhanced in a concentration dependent manner.When the concentration of 1,10-decanediol was 0.4 mg/mL,the extracellular protease activity of A.salmon was obviously weakened,and its movement ability was alsoweakened,and the formation rate of biofilm was reduced by 76.92%.It can be seen that 1,10-decanediol has a good effect of quorum sensing inhibition,which can be used as a new quorum sensing inhibitor for preservation of aquatic products.2.When 0.1mg/ml 1,10-decanediol solution was added,the pH value and NaCl mass fraction of A.salmon were changed.It was found that the inhibition of1,10-decanediol on quorum sensing of A.salmon was enhanced when the external conditions were acidic and alkaline;When the mass fraction of NaCl increases from 1% to 2%,the inhibitory effect of 1,10-decanediol on quorum sensing of A.salmon will be weakened,and when the mass fraction of NaCl increases to 3%,the inhibitory effect of 1,10-decanediol on quorum sensing of A.salmon will be enhanced.3.Different concentrations of 1,10-decanediol solution were used to preserve Larimichthys crocea fillets,to explore the sensory score and freshness of Larimichthys crocea fillets during storage.The results showed that the shelf life of the control group was only about 6 days,while that of the treatment group with1,10-decanediol solution reached 14 days,8 days longer than that of the control group;It was also found that the effects of different concentrations of1,10-decanediol solution on TBA and water holding capacity of fillets were similar in prometaphase storage,and there were significant differences at the beginning of the 12 th day.Analysis combined with other indicators,the higher the concentration of preservative was,the better the effect of preservation was.
